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
349 13130073098 19365142987 3915143791 88365213
523 2259608 91604
523 2259608 91604
01676 0748 470958 1476
All about undefined
Interested in learning more?
523 2259608 91604
01676 0748 470958 1476
See more
59826315 75325832
633 1421388035 565308377
See more
87612 30 929188569
48631121 303280 66
See more